  • What is Diogenes of Sinope best known for?

    Diogenes is renowned for his ascetic lifestyle, his embrace of Cynicism, and his provocative actions that challenged social conventions and philosophical norms of his time. He advocated for self-sufficiency, simplicity, and honesty.
